Understanding the Israel-Iran Conflict: A Quick Overview

Before we jump into the Twitterverse, let's get a handle on the main players and the core issues at stake. The Israel-Iran conflict is essentially a multifaceted struggle, rooted in a complex history of political, religious, and strategic rivalries. You've got Israel, a nation with strong ties to the West, and Iran, a theocratic state with significant regional influence. These two countries have been at odds for decades, with tensions escalating at various points due to proxy wars, nuclear programs, and ideological differences. The conflict isn't just about territory; it involves questions of national security, regional dominance, and the very future of the Middle East. It's a high-stakes game with significant implications for global stability, which is why it constantly makes international news. The Main Actors and Key Issues

  • Israel: A key US ally in the Middle East, Israel views Iran's nuclear program and its support for militant groups as major threats. They've been involved in numerous military actions and intelligence operations to counter Iranian influence. Israel's security concerns are a primary driver of its foreign policy, and they see Iran as an existential threat.
  • Iran: Iran, on the other hand, views Israel as an illegitimate state and a Western outpost in the region. They support various militant groups, such as Hezbollah in Lebanon and Hamas in Gaza, who are actively involved in confrontations with Israel. Iran's nuclear program is a constant source of international scrutiny, with many countries fearing it aims to develop nuclear weapons.
  • Proxy Conflicts: The conflict often plays out through proxy wars, with Iran supporting groups that are in conflict with Israel. This includes incidents in Lebanon, Gaza, Syria, and Yemen, making the conflict a regional instability flashpoint.
  • Nuclear Program: Iran's nuclear program is a major point of contention. Israel, along with many Western countries, fears it could lead to the development of nuclear weapons, leading to military action.

How to Find Reliable Information on the Conflict

Navigating the digital landscape to find reliable information is crucial. So, how can you sift through the noise and find trustworthy sources related to the Israel-Iran war on Twitter? Here are a few tips to help you out.

Following Trusted Sources

Start by following reputable news organizations and journalists known for their accuracy and objectivity. Some good examples are the Associated Press, Reuters, BBC News, and major newspapers like The New York Times and The Wall Street Journal. Checking the official accounts of these organizations is an easy way to stay informed. Many journalists working on-the-ground, in the conflict zone, also offer valuable insights.

Verifying Information

Before you believe everything you read, take a moment to verify the information. Check if other credible sources are reporting the same story. Look for corroborating evidence, such as multiple sources reporting the same facts. Be skeptical of information that seems too good to be true, and always consider the source. Cross-referencing information from multiple sources can help ensure you’re getting an accurate picture of the events.

Spotting Misinformation and Bias

Be vigilant about spotting misinformation and propaganda. Be wary of accounts that consistently promote one-sided narratives or spread unverified claims. Check for the account's history and whether they have a reputation for accuracy. Consider the potential bias of any source. Even credible sources may have their own perspectives, and it's essential to understand those biases to fully assess the information being shared. Checking for multiple sources will help you identify potential biases.

Utilizing Search Tools and Hashtags

Use Twitter’s search function to find relevant tweets. Search for specific keywords, phrases, or hashtags related to the conflict. Popular hashtags such as #Israel, #Iran, #Gaza, and #MiddleEast can help you discover the latest updates and discussions. Advanced search options allow you to refine your search based on date, engagement, or user. Regularly monitoring the trending hashtags can also give you insight into the key issues and events.
